About the Opportunity


Our client is seeking an experienced Senior Purchasing Manager to lead MRO and indirect procurement activities across multiple manufacturing locations. This is a highly visible leadership role responsible for developing and executing sourcing strategies, managing supplier relationships, driving cost savings, and building a high-performing purchasing organization.

The ideal candidate will bring 10+ years of purchasing/procurement experience with significant MRO and indirect spend exposure, along with a demonstrated history of leading teams across multiple locations. Experience managing remote and geographically dispersed employees is highly valued.


Key Responsibilities

  • Lead MRO and indirect purchasing strategy across multiple manufacturing locations, aligning procurement activities with broader business objectives.
  • Develop and implement sourcing strategies that leverage market intelligence, supplier capabilities, cost opportunities, and supply chain risk considerations.
  • Lead negotiations for complex supplier agreements, RFPs, and RFQs to achieve competitive pricing and maximize total cost of ownership.
  • Manage and develop a geographically dispersed purchasing team, including direct and indirect reports and remote employees.
  • Establish supplier performance expectations, KPIs, scorecards, and continuous improvement initiatives.
  • Identify cost-reduction opportunities across MRO and indirect categories while maintaining quality, service, and operational continuity.
  • Partner closely with Operations, Engineering, Finance, and other functional leaders across multiple facilities.
  • Monitor supply chain risks and develop mitigation strategies to protect manufacturing operations.
  • Drive procurement process improvements, standardization, and continuous improvement/Kaizen initiatives across locations.
  • Ensure compliance with purchasing policies, governance requirements, contractual obligations, and applicable legal and sustainability standards.
  • Prepare and present procurement performance, savings, supplier, and MRO-related reporting to senior leadership.
  • Resolve complex supplier and internal purchasing issues through strong negotiation, communication, and problem-solving skills.
  • Recruit, coach, develop, and evaluate purchasing team members while fostering accountability, collaboration, and high morale.
